Hi! Looking for advice, one engine on the ‘98 speedster crapped out last weekend, it will spark but won’t run. We replaced the coil and plugs…didn’t take. I was thinking stator magneto, but have very little experience with jet boats? Any suggestions are appreciated.

Let's go back a step. You say it has spark.... that would indicate that the electrical is fine. So I would be very surprised after that if it is the plugs, coil or the magneto.

So then, fuel: If one engine is running and the other is not and they are drawing from the same fuel, it is not the fuel itself. In the fuel category, though you can also have carbs/injectors (not sure which ones you have). If it is a carb: was it running rough before it cut out? Or running rough before you turned it off and it wouldn't start? If injector: you can swap an injector with the other engine to see if it helps. Also check the electrical connectors going to the injectors. Lots to look at in the fuel system... fuel pump too.

Final thing to make it run is compression. For that, you start diagnosis by doing a compression test on the engine. Got a compression tester? You can get cheap ones cheap on Amazon. May be able to borrow one from AutoZone or similar. Lack of compression can indicate that the head gasket is blown or rings are bad on the pistons or you have a valve issue.
